How our sorting works

The order in which job vacancies are displayed is determined by a composite score based on the following factors:

  • Keyword Relevance: How well your search terms match the vacancy details. We prioritize matches found in the job title, followed by job requirements, location names, and educational levels. Matches within general employer information or the organization's name carry a lower weight.
  • Commercial Prioritization (Premium Jobs): Vacancies paid for by employers ('Premium' or 'Sponsored') receive a ranking boost and will appear higher in the search results.
  • Recency (Date Relevance): Newer vacancies are prioritized. The relevance score of a vacancy is reduced by half once the posting is older than 30 days.
  • Proximity (Distance Relevance): Vacancies located closer to your search location are ranked higher. For vacancies located more than 30 km from the search center, the relevance score is halved.
The final ranking is established by multiplying all these individual factors to calculate the total relevance score.

    Job description

    Part Time Permanent Position
    2-3 days a week
    City of London
    Hybrid working/Remote working
    £42-47k FTE

    Our client is seeking an experienced Payroll & Pensions Officer to join their busy team

    Duties include;

    Provide input to the external payroll bureau and review outputs to ensure accuracy and completeness
    Validate payroll calculations, including pay, deductions, and statutory requirements
    Monitor and reconcile bureau outputs, identifying and resolving discrepancies
    Ensure timely and accurate payroll processing in line with organisational deadlines
    Ensure compliance with all relevant payroll and pension legislation
    Oversee payments to third parties (e.g. HMRC, pension providers, and other statutory bodies)
    Manage and respond to requests for information in line with legal and regulatory requirements
    Maintain accurate records and audit trails
    Support pension processes including contributions, enrolment, and reporting
    Liaise with pension providers to ensure accurate and compliant administration
    Monitor pension data integrity and resolve issues
    Act as the key point of contact within the organisation for payroll and pensions queries
    Build strong relationships with internal teams and external providers
    Provide clear and timely communication on payroll matters
    Support the implementation of a new payroll bureau and system
    Contribute to system testing, data validation, and process design
    Assist with transition planning and knowledge transfer
    You will able to;

    Demonstrable experience in public sector payroll
    Strong knowledge of pensions administration and legislation
    Experience working with external payroll bureaus
    Proven ability to validate payroll outputs and resolve discrepancies
    Good understanding of statutory and third-party payment processes
    Strong attention to detail and accuracy
    Experience of payroll system or bureau transitions
    Knowledge of relevant public sector schemes (e.g. LGPS, NHS, Teachers, etc.)
    Familiarity with payroll compliance and audit requirements
